Description

Check-In: 4:00pm Check-Out: 11:00am
Designed for families and golfers, The Caravelle Resort has an expansive pool deck, a game room, and more.

Located in a quiet hotel zone north of downtown's traffic, families are attracted to this hotel for the pools and beachfront locale. Golfers come year round. Guests have playing privileges at the private Dunes Golf and Beach Club, which is less than three miles away. At least one adult of 21 years of age must be in the room at all times for all buildings except for Sea Mark Tower & Carolina Dunes (25).

Water attractions include a complex with a 65 by 30-foot pool; a children's Wild Water pool, lazy river, and a 15-person spa tub (Seasonal). A solarium offers year-round 45 by 12-foot pool paired with a four-person spa tub. Outside, another four-person spa tub provides open air soaking.

The Caravelle Resort offers 620 air-conditioned guestrooms, suites and two and three-bedroom condominiums. Most accommodations provide either a full kitchen or a kitchenette that includes a four-burner range, a microwave oven, a full-size refrigerator, a toaster, and a coffeemaker and comes with dishes, flatware, and cookware.

Frequently Asked Questions about The Caravelle Resort

How many rooms are available at the resort?

There are 540 rooms are available at this property.

How many buildings comprise your units at The Caravelle Resort?

There is one main building at the resort with the highest tower reaching a height of 15 stories. The entire resort, however, is comprised of nine buildings.

Does The Caravelle Resort have a restaurant on-site? A lounge? Café? Gift Shop?

Yes. The Marco Polo Poolside Bar & Grill serves up tasty items like hamburgers and refreshing drinks. The Santa Maria Restaurant features breakfast a la carte and buffet-style daily, while guests can also get a slice of pizza at the Pirate’s Cove Ice Cream & Sandwich Shop, or grab a drink at Liquids Lounge. A Gift and Sundry shop, open from 8am-9pm, sells groceries, beer, wine and sundry items.
